Young Woman's Electrifying Michael Jackson Cover On The Voice
One woman on The Voice turned in an electrifying and awe-inspiring performance during her blind audition as she covered a beloved Michael Jackson tune.
Michael Jackson was an entertainer unlike any other. He was blessed with an abundance of God-given musical talent. Michael’s career, which started when he was still a tiny child as a member of The Jackson 5, spanned decades.
Michael changed pop music several times throughout his career. He wasn’t nicknamed the “King of Pop” for no reason. Nearly everything he put out was a hit and ended up topping the charts. His songs, which are legendary and iconic, are still widely heard on the radio and covered by many different artists, including one woman who recently auditioned for The Voice.
Elyscia Jefferson, a 20-year-old, gave a stunning, electrifying and dazzling performance of Michael’s “P.Y.T.” Her voice is beautiful, very much sounding like someone who would be right at home on the radio now.
Moments after opening her voice to sing the opening lyrics, Shay Mooney of Dan + Shay is taken aback by her sound.
“Oh my gosh,” he says to his fellow judge and bandmate Dan Smyers.
After registering his amazement at Elyscia’s vocal talent, Dan + Shay slams their buttons, turning their chairs around and signaling their desire to add the talented young singer to their team. But they weren’t the only judges who quickly hit their buttons.
Mere seconds after Dan + Shay flip around, Reba McEntire, the Queen of Country Music, has also heard everything she needs to hear. She turns her chair around for Elyscia. Chance the Rapper is not too far behind as he flips his chair around.
Elyscia’s audition is fabulous as she is obviously a gifted singer who seems able to produce such beautiful sounds effortlessly.
